Establish a Favorable Mindset
To guarantee an effective very first dental check out for your child, it is very important to establish a positive way of thinking. Begin by talking with your child concerning the see in a tranquil and calming manner. Stress that seeing the dental practitioner is a regular part of taking care of their teeth which the dentist exists to help keep their smile healthy and balanced. Stay clear of utilizing unfavorable words or phrases that might produce worry or anxiousness.
Instead, concentrate on the favorable elements, such as getting to see amazing dental tools or getting a sticker or plaything at the end of the check out. Urge your youngster to ask questions and share any kind of issues they might have.
Acquaint Your Kid With the Dental Office
Beginning by taking your youngster to the dental office before their very first check out, so they can come to be familiar with the surroundings and really feel more at ease. This action is essential in helping to lower any type of stress and anxiety or fear your youngster might have about mosting likely to the dental expert.
Here are a couple of ways to familiarize your child with the dental workplace:
- ** Schedule a fast tour **: Call the dental workplace and ask if you can bring your youngster for a short scenic tour. This will allow them to see the waiting area, treatment areas, and meet the pleasant team.
- ** Role-play at home **: Pretend to be the dental expert and have your child sit in a chair while you analyze their teeth. This will help them understand what to anticipate throughout their real check out.
- ** Review publications or see video clips **: Search for youngsters's books or videos that discuss what takes place at the dental practitioner. This can help your youngster feel a lot more comfortable and prepared.
Outfit Your Youngster With Healthy Oral Routines
Developing healthy oral behaviors is essential for your kid's dental wellness and overall health. By instructing your youngster good dental routines from an early age, you can aid protect against dental cavity, gum illness, and various other dental wellness issues.
Begin by instructing them the relevance of cleaning their teeth two times a day, using a soft-bristled to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ste. Show them the correct brushing technique, making certain they comb all surface areas of their teeth and gums.
Motivate them to floss everyday to get rid of plaque and food fragments from in between their teeth.
Limit their intake of sugary treats and drinks, as these can add to dental cavity.
Finally, routine regular dental examinations for your youngster to preserve their oral health and wellness and resolve any type of issues early.
